On February 12, 2018, President Trump announced his intent to nominate Brasel to an undetermined seat on the United States District Court for the District of Minnesota. . On February 15, 2018, her nomination was sent to the Senate. President Trump nominated Brasel to the seat vacated by Judge Ann D. Montgomery, who assumed senior status on May 31, 2016 and Judge Diana Murphy who was elevated to the Eighth Circuit October 13, 1994. On April 11, 2018, a hearing on her nomination was held before the Senate Judiciary Committee. On May 10, 2018, her nomination was reported out of committee by a voice vote. Brasel was rated as "unanimously well qualified" by the American Bar Association. On August 28, 2018, her nomination was confirmed by voice vote. She received her judicial commission on September 13, 2018.

Upon graduation from law school, Brasel served as a law clerk to Judge Donald P. Lay of the United States Court of Appeals for the Eighth Circuit. After her clerkship, Judge Brasel worked in private practice as an associate with the Minneapolis law firm of Leonard, Street and Deinard (now Stinson). She then became a partner at Greene Espel, P.L.L.P., where her practice focused on business and employment litigation. Prior to her state judicial appointment, she spent three years as an Assistant United States Attorney for the District of Minnesota, where she prosecuted narcotics, firearms, and financial crimes. In 2011, Governor of Minnesota Mark Dayton appointed Brasel to the Minnesota State District Court for the Fourth Judicial District, where she served until becoming a federal judge. Judge Brasel is the former Chair of the Board of Directors of the Domestic Abuse Project in Minneapolis.

Nancy Ellen Brasel (born 1969) is a United States District Judge of the United States District Court for the District of Minnesota.
